Know before you go
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ring Cahal Pech Archaeological Reserve.
- Visit early in the morning to avoid crowds and enjoy a cooler climate.
- Wear comfortable shoes, as the terrain can be uneven and rocky in places.
- Bring a camera to capture the breathtaking views and intricate ruins.
- Consider hiring a local guide for an enriched experience exploring the site's history.
- Stay hydrated and bring snacks, as the reserve can take a few hours to explore fully.

Getting There
-
Car
If you are traveling by car, head towards San Ignacio. From the center of San Ignacio, take W. Ford Young Drive, which is a short road that leads directly to Cahal Pech Archaeological Reserve. The reserve is located at the address 4WWG+9CJ, W. Ford Young Drive. There are signs along the way to guide you. Parking is available near the entrance.
-
Public Transportation
To reach Cahal Pech using public transportation, take a local bus or shuttle from your location in Southern Belize to San Ignacio. Once you arrive in San Ignacio, you can either walk or take a taxi to W. Ford Young Drive. The taxi fare is typically around $5-10 BZD. If you choose to walk, it's about a 15-20 minute walk from the bus terminal to the archaeological site.
-
Walking
If you are already in San Ignacio and prefer to walk, you can easily reach Cahal Pech Archaeological Reserve by heading towards W. Ford Young Drive. From the town center, walk west on Burns Avenue and then turn left on W. Ford Young Drive. The reserve is located on the right side as you ascend the hill. Make sure to wear comfortable shoes, as the terrain may be uneven.
